The project has been on the back burner for a week or two for various reasons but I am thinking of such things as chainsets , stems and bars.I saw this:

http://www.planet-x-bikes.co.uk/i/q/CSOOTC/on_one_external_bearing_track_crankset

and although it isn't the lightest out there it looks ok ( I like the polished one) and also comes with the bb. For those who know about these things what do you think? What else might you recommend?

A few things to think about:
1. Do you want 1/8" or 3/32" (there will be a much larger choice of components with 3/32")

2. Will you be able to get the gear inches you want with 48T (maybe it will work out quite expensive if you have to immediately buy another chainring)

3. I think square taper is more aesthetically pleasing, especially for track, fixed and single-speed, but maybe that's just me.
